Topic Synopsis
This subtopic focuses on the practical skills and underpinning knowledge required to install shopfitting fitments safely, accurately, and to specification in a live workplace environment. Learners will develop competence in interpreting information, selecting resources, applying safe working practices, and ensuring work meets contractual quality standards while minimising damage and adhering to project timelines.
Key Concepts & Core Principles
- First and second fixing: Installing structural components like floor joists and roof trusses (first fixing) followed by finishing elements such as skirting boards, doors, and kitchen units (second fixing).
- Setting out and levelling: Using laser levels, spirit levels, and string lines to ensure accuracy in marking positions for walls, doors, and windows, following technical drawings.
- Jointing techniques: Advanced methods like mortise and tenon, dovetail, and finger joints for creating strong, durable connections in joinery products.
- Health and safety compliance: Adhering to COSHH regulations, using PPE correctly, and conducting risk assessments for tasks like working at height or using power tools.
- Material selection and sustainability: Choosing appropriate timber grades, engineered wood products, and understanding moisture content to prevent warping or decay.
Exam Tips & Revision Strategies
- Gather a variety of evidence: annotated photos, video walkthroughs, and signed witness statements covering each criterion.
- Ensure your risk assessments are live documents that reflect the specific hazards of the site, not generic templates.
- Keep a daily log of material usage and time spent to demonstrate resource management and productivity.
- For the portfolio, show clearly how you rectified any snags or defects to meet the required specification.
- For the NVQ portfolio, include annotated photographs showing key stages: setting out, protection measures, and finished installation with quality checks.
- Cross-reference each piece of evidence to the relevant performance criteria and knowledge statements in the unit specification.
- During professional discussion, be prepared to explain how you would handle a variation order or unexpected site condition without breaching health and safety or contract terms.
- Keep a site diary or log to demonstrate consistent application of safe working practices and time management across multiple installation tasks.
Common Misconceptions & Mistakes to Avoid
- Misinterpreting scale or elevation views on drawings, leading to incorrect positioning of fitments.
- Failing to check for services (e.g., electrics, plumbing) before drilling, risking damage and safety breaches.
- Using fixings that are not adequate for the substrate or load, resulting in later failure.
- Neglecting to protect polished or veneered surfaces during cutting and assembly operations.

Examiner Marking Points
- Award credit for accurate interpretation of a range of information sources including drawings, schedules, and method statements.
- Look for consistent application of RAMS (Risk Assessment and Method Statements) throughout the installation process.
- Expect the learner to select correct quantities and types of materials, avoiding excessive waste.
- Evidence of proactive measures to protect vulnerable surfaces and floor coverings (e.g., use of dust sheets, corner guards).
- Confirm that the finished work meets dimensional accuracy and alignment criteria as stated in the specification.
- Accurate take-off of materials from drawings and specifications, with no omissions or over-ordering.
- Clear evidence of complying with current health and safety legislation, including wearing correct PPE and erecting appropriate signage/barriers.
- Correct use of hand tools, power tools, and access equipment in line with manufacturer instructions and safe practices.
